CanoScan Lide 70 - good stuff
Review of Canon CanoScan LiDE 70 by mandarin

Advantages: small size, one button operation, no power supply needed
Disadvantages: some supplied software a bit dated

...machine. I'd seen an earlier Canon and was impressed by the size and functions offered so bought the latest model. Very easy to set up, just run the cd and choose the full install. When it's all done restart machine and plug in the scanner. Some of the software has since been removed as not really useful or duplicated what I already had but without doubt the best bit is the push button operation for copy, print, send by email or make a pdf. Lost transparancies revived
Review of Canon CanoScan 5000F by Conicview

Advantages: Easy to use
Disadvantages: character recognisition software not included

...changed. For example, the Canon Scanner absolutely dead simple to install and use. For those who enjoy being spoon fed by computers, the scanner will automatically size the objects for scanning. For example, it is a postcard, then it will just scan the postcard and not the entire surrounding area. However, you can adjust the size if necessary. There is also a choice between colour, text and black and white and a facility for gray-scaling. There are ...
